## Data Stores — Splitwise Assignment Service

Branchly's assignment service maps visitor IDs to experiment variants. Assignments are deterministic (hashed), persisted in the `assignments` table for audit only. Plugin authors: never write to this table directly; use the `/assign` endpoint. Variant configs live in `experiments`, refreshed every 60 seconds. Read replicas serve plugin queries; the primary is off-limits. Read-replica access uses the connection string below.

primary connection of yagep-kahip = redis://giliel_svc:zYiKsLL2PLpfPL@db-348f.xolmarsys.corp:5432/fenwyn

FAQ: Why does the spreadsheet export in Ledgerloom eat so much memory?

Short answer: the exporter builds the whole workbook in RAM before streaming it out, so a 200k-row export can balloon past a gigabyte. We're moving to chunked writes, but until then, keep test exports under 50k rows and use the staging box, not your laptop. If the export worker crashes and leaves the shared cache locked, you can unlock it yourself — the recovery passphrase is just below.

strongbox words: norwyn-wenael-aldvan-aldiel-wendor-holael

/*
 * Idempotency keys for payment retries (Pinemarten billing core).
 * Every outbound charge to the Saltwhistle processor carries a key
 * derived from order id plus attempt epoch, so a retried request
 * after a timeout cannot double-charge. Keys are stored with a TTL;
 * once expired, a replay is treated as a new charge, so the TTL must
 * comfortably exceed the longest retry horizon including dead-letter
 * replays. Reviewers: check TTL changes against the retry schedule.
 * The governing constants are defined immediately below.
 */

tuning constants:
QUOTAS = {
    "druwyn": 5,
    "holix": 5,
    "zorath": 5,
    "holwyn": 10,
}

**Q: Why does the Cartwell fuel report show negative usage?**

Negative values mean a tank-sensor reset mid-window. The report subtracts readings naively; it does not dedupe resets. Fix: rerun with the reset-aware flag. Historical backfills need the archive job, which authenticates with the passphrase below.

strongbox words: sordor-druix